Every single festival lineup of the season so far has made me simultaneously excited for good music and totally freak out about how the hell I’m going to afford rent (may as well get into the festival spirit and live in a tent). Sugar Mountain is no exception. The line-up covers all bases.

Nas: for when I wanna be a massive white girl.

ODESZA: for when I wanna dance like a massive white girl.

Midnight Juggernauts: for when I wanna get intergalactic.

Wax’o Paradiso: for when I wanna boogie.

Oscar Key Sung x Cassius Select: for when I wanna cry over such a perfect collab.

King Gizzard & the Lizard Wizard: for when I wanna feel good, but weird, but good.

…And then everything in between.

Sugar Mountain is sure to tickle a little bit of everyone’s fancy. Being held on January 24, the festival’s usual iconic Forum Theatre venue has changed next year to the Victorian College of Arts (VCA), and will feature five stages. Three outdoor, and two indoor stages. The tickets have been capped to only 5,500 offerings this year, which means you’ll have to get in quick when they go on sale on Monday October 20 at 9am.
